How to tie fiber optic cables to power poles

Fiber optic cables can be safely installed on power poles using aerial deployment techniques, typically with ADSS cables that are self-supporting and non-conductive, following strict safety and regulatory standards.

Planning and Preparation

Before installation, survey the route to identify pole locations, obstacles, and environmental conditions. Obtain all necessary permits from local authorities and coordinate with utility companies if sharing poles with power lines. Determine splice points, slack storage, and service loops in advance to ensure proper cable management during and after installation .

Choosing the Right Cable

For deployment near power lines, use All-Dielectric Self-Supporting (ADSS) cables, which are non-conductive and designed to withstand electrical fields, wind, ice, and animal damage. ADSS cables contain glass-reinforced plastic or aramid fibers for tensile strength instead of metal, making them safe for installation in the power space . Lightweight and flexible cables reduce strain on poles and simplify installation.

Installation Techniques

  1. Pole Attachment: Secure the fiber to the pole using non-metallic hardware. Cables can be lashed to a messenger wire or existing telecom cables if permitted. Ensure proper clearance from electrical lines and other low-voltage cables, maintaining separation mid-span to account for sag .
  2. Sag and Tension: Calculate sag based on span length and cable weight, typically limiting sag to less than 2% of span length and tension to less than 30% of cable minimum breaking strength . Proper sag prevents overstressing the fiber and ensures clearance from obstacles.
  3. Splice Closures and Service Loops: Attach splice closures securely to poles with service loops, using showshoe turnarounds or cable loops that respect the cable's minimum bend radius. Avoid leaving loose or hanging cables .
  4. Environmental Protection: Use cables with UV-resistant jackets (carbon black additives) and ensure they are clear of trees, buildings, and other obstructions. Consider extreme weather conditions when planning installation .

Safety Considerations

All personnel must follow OSHA regulations, National Electrical Safety Code (NESC), and local safety rules. Use safety harnesses, insulated gloves, and bucket trucks when working near live electrical lines. Inspect all equipment before use and ensure materials are secured to prevent falling hazards .

Testing and Maintenance

After installation, test all fiber connections to verify signal integrity. Maintain documentation of permits, inspections, and compliance checks. Regularly monitor the network to prevent damage from weather, wildlife, or mechanical stress . By following these steps, fiber optic cables can be safely and efficiently connected to power poles, ensuring long-term reliability and compliance with safety standards.
